The "Banana for Scale" meme originated on Reddit in 2012, where users placed bananas next to objects to indicate size. It quickly spread to Imgur and Twitter. The banana's standard size made it ideal for these comparisons. The meme gained new significance when Elon Musk added a banana decal, featuring a banana holding a smaller banana, to SpaceX’s Ship 31. This move celebrated the meme and highlighted the rocket's scale, solidifying the banana's status as a pop culture icon.
